Abstract:
1529694 Feeding sheets XEROX CORP 24 Oct 1975 43918/75 Heading B8R Sheets are separated from the bottom of a pile on an inclined tray 24, Figs. 1 and 2, by a friction belt separator 110, Figs. 1, 2 and 3, forming a nip with a stationary friction restraining member 100, and advanced to feed rollers 34 and thence to a belt conveyer 50, in two stages, first to a point short of the rollers 34 and second on to an exposure platen 12. The pile is aligned by side guides 26, 27 and a front stop surface 130, while a member 150 presses the pile on to the tray. Exhaustion of sheets is detected to stop the machine. When a sheet is fed to the conveyer 50, its leading edge is sensed by a switch which reverses the conveyer 50 to move the sheet back against a register stop member 40, a baffle 200 closing on the member 40 to prevent upward movement of the trailing edge. A member 400 causes the belt to exert less friction during its reverse movement.
